Discussions about the Indian cricket team are hot these days who will lead the Test team in future. Meanwhile, former cricketer and commentator Navjot Singh Sidhu has made an important suggestion. He believes that if Shubman Gill is made the next captain of the Test team, he should not hide in the batting order, but should send him to the opening position or number 3 so that he can fully fulfill the responsibility of leadership.

Sidhu said, “If you make Gill a captain in Test cricket, play him at opener or number 3. Then do not give him a safety shield. He will have to lead him from the front like Virat Kohli, not to try to save them by sending them to number 4.”

This statement comes at a time when there are discussions of Virat Kohli’s break or possible retirement from Test cricket. In case of Kohli being out of the Test team, the number 4 position will be emptied, which is considered very important in Indian cricket. This is the same place where Sachin Tendulkar and then Virat Kohli have played the role of the team’s backbone for years.

Sidhu said that to play at number 4, there is a need for a player who can bat for a long time and remove the team from the crisis. He suggested the names of KL Rahul and Shreyas Iyer for this position. According to him, these two players are technically strong and can score runs under difficult conditions.

Sidhu’s statement indicates that the selectors and the coaching team should consider his mental and technical side before making Gill a captain amidst speculation of Gautam Gambhir’s coaching setup.

The Indian Test team is going through a change and in such a situation it is not enough to give young players just a chance, giving them the right role and trusting them.
